Join us for an intimate, honest, and uplifting lunchtime conversation with authors Allen Klein and Sherry Richert Belul
About this Event

Join us for an intimate, honest, and uplifting lunchtime conversation with authors Allen Klein (Embracing Life After Loss) and Sherry Richert Belul (The Love List of a Lifetime), as they explore how love, humor, story, and thoughtful preparation can help us face loss, illness, and the final chapters of life with greater ease, tenderness, and courage.

Allen and Sherry will share what inspired each of them to write their books- one born from grief and the healing power of humor, the other from a lifelong devotion to helping people leave behind love, stories, and practical guidance for those they cherish.

About the Speakers

Sherry Richert Belul, founder of Simply Celebrate, helps people find creative, intentional, and impactful ways to celebrate life and to express love for family and friends. As a certified life coach, Sherry supports people in living their best lives—lives full of joy, success, engagement, and meaningful relationships. She is the author of The Love List of a Lifetime: Your Essential End-of-Life Planner with Practical Notes and Instructions for the Loved Ones You Leave Behind as well as Say It Now: 33 Creative Ways to Say I LOVE YOU to the Most Important People in Your Life. Sherry is co-host of the Heart Wisdom Author Panel and co-founder of The Secret Agents of Change kindness project. Her work has been featured in the New York Times, Town & Country, and the Wall Street Journal. Sherry has been interviewed on countless podcasts and has led a variety of workshops in an array of venues ranging from bookstores to large companies.

Meet Allen Klein…the world’s only Jollytologist®. He is an award-winning professional speaker, TEDx presenter, and author of over 30 books including You Can’t Ruin My Day, Embracing Life After Loss and The Healing Power of Humor.
